- Summary:
- Design and performance evaluation of several potential crankcase ventilation systems and the ultimate choice of the subject tube to air cleaner system are described. The performance considerations include: blowby control, fresh air ventilation, carburetor calibration effects, owner maintenance, backfire protection, and carburetor icing tendencies. Compliance data for the American Motors Crankcase-To-Air Cleaner Engine Ventilation System for the California MVPCB Blow Emission Standard are also demonstrated
